This video exposes critical compatibility issues between the Radian Talon 45/90 Safety and several popular AR-15 aftermarket triggers, particularly in the 45-degree short-throw setting. The speaker, demonstrating high technical authority, details how 'tolerance stacking' can cause malfunctions, with specific interference points identified on Geissele triggers. Both Radian and Geissele acknowledge the problem, suggesting the 90-degree setting or alternative safeties as solutions, but the speaker criticizes the lack of upfront consumer warnings.

This expert-level guide from School of the American Rifle details how tolerance stacking can cause M4 feed ramp issues, even with high-quality parts. It visually demonstrates how barrel extension ramps can overhang receiver ramps, leading to feeding failures evidenced by copper residue. The guide outlines the diagnostic process and the necessary gunsmithing steps to correct this common AR-15 problem.
